
A complex table represents ____________.
(A) Only one factor or variable
(B) Always two factors or variables
(C) Two or more factors or variables
(D) All the above

We need to find out the correct option for a complex table.
A complex table is one which shows more than one characteristics of the theta.
A table is an arrangement of data in rows and columns, or possibly in a more complex structure. Tables are widely used in communication, research, and data analysis.
A complex table summarizes the complicated information and presents them into two or more interrelated categories. For example, if there are two coordinate factors, the table is called a two-way table or bi-variety table; if the number of coordinate groups is three, it is a case of three-way tabulation, and if it is based on more than three coordinate groups, the table is known as higher order tabulation or a manifold tabulation.
$\therefore $ The option (C) is the correct answer.
Note: In a complex table (also known as a manifold table) data are presented according to two or more characteristics simultaneously. The complex tables are two –way or three-way tables according to whether two or three characteristics are presented simultaneously.
Complex tables are three types
Double or Two-way table
Three-way table
Manifold (or higher order) table.
